Note 1. Optical and electrical specifications are given for the specified drive current at a 25 C junction temperature.
Note 2. Operating temperature is for LED die junction. Lower temperatures improve lumen maintenance.
Light Output Characteristics
Luminous Flux vs. Current
Luminous Flux vs. Current
When operating at drive currents higher than test currents indicated do not exceed maximum recommended junction temperature.
Higher drive currents increase luminous flux but also increase thermal load. Without proper heat sinking, lower efficacy (lumens per
watt) and lower lumen maintenance may result. For dimming significantly below test currents indicated, pulse width modulation is
recommended for maximum consistency and stability of light properties.
Luminous Flux vs. Junction Temperature
Light output from LED die will decrease with increasing junction temperature. This effect is particularly acute for die in the 580 to 750
nm range. As a result it is recommended that the LED array heat sink design be optimized to maintain the die junction temperature as
low as possible.
